<h3>The Cuban missile crises </h3>
The cuban missile crises occured when America discovered through their spy planes that the soviet union was building and installing missiles in Cuba.
President Kennedy reacted by placing a naval quarantine on cuba.
The aim of this quarantine was to prevent the Soviets from transporting more military supplies.
He demanded the removal of the missiles already there and the total destruction of the sites.

America's first government was inadequately prepared and weak for a number of reasons.
Firstly, the U.S. government could not print money, and when they could, the US currency was useless outside of the United States.
Secondly, the U.S. could not impose taxes in a federal level for fear of public outcry, especially as they had just broken away from Great Britain for the very reason of taxes. This meant that the U.S. government had no funds for any governmental actions.
Thirdly, the federal government had no foreign relations powers. Each state individually made trade deals and alliances with different nations, independent on each other.
Fourthly, the U.S. was not able to make good on their war debts and promises to investors, both at home and also foreigners.
